Design That Resonates with Local Users
We design for how people in our target audience actually use their phones. That means accounting for slower internet, varied screen sizes, and multiple languages. Your grandmother should be able to navigate your app without needing help.
Developing and Testing in Real-World Conditions
We test on older Android devices with flaky connections, not only on the latest phones with perfect networks. The app has to function in secondary cities during peak hours, not just in a developer's lab.

Designed for the Realities of the Indian Market
Developing apps for India involves tackling challenges unseen in Silicon Valley, such as flaky connectivity, users speaking many languages, a wide range of device capabilities, and a variety of payment methods.
We have partnered with businesses across twelve states. A delivery app that runs smoothly in Bangalore could stumble in Patna if local conditions aren't considered.
- Offline capability when the connection drops
- Support for local languages and scripts
- Various payment methods, including cash on delivery integration
- Built for budget Android devices
- Efficient data usage for restricted data plans
